Pros

Was a good place to work for me but have tried to objective with the pros and cons 1. Talented and friendly people at the lower levels of the hierarchy 2. Excellent benefits (food, insurance, days off, pension etc..) 3. Great office in Cork 4. Good work life balance in engineering 5. Easy interview process (but does seem to work as the company gets in good engineers)

Cons

1. Poor leadership (Not sure what happened. They seemed to have direction, will and clear vision but it's become very muddled. Recent changes have been for the worse) 2. Lots of new middle manager hires, not sure how many of them are necessary 3. Very homogenous company (Have even met women in the company who think women cannot program well and the best way for women to get into software firms is through soft skill positions) 4. No emphasis on building a good Engineering Culture (good available talent being wasted to a certain extent) 5. Career progression can be quite difficult. Impression seems to matter more than actual work delivered 6. Salaries are much lower than industry standards

Pros

- Founding CEO & CTO actually care about their company and employees and treat them well. They are transparent, honest, and understand the importance of taking care of their people. - The majority of leaders and managers want to enable their people to succeed. - Many great managers and co-workers who contribute to an overall positive and respectful culture. - A company who actually cares about their customers and puts customer support at the top of their priority list. - Remote work is well supported and embraced. - Family/personal life is important and valued. - Excellent benefits and perks. How one is treated when leaving a company is a good indicator of the true heart and culture of their leaders and co-workers. In my final weeks of employment at Teamwork, I felt overwhelmingly appreciated and honored for my contributions and time invested there. And that was not only coming from my awesome co-workers, but even the founding CEO and CTO each took time to personally express their appreciation and wish me all the best in my next endeavor. And there were many others who made my exit so memorable and encouraging. That's the kind of people who make Teamwork an incredible place to work.

Cons

- Can be stressful at times trying to meet deadlines. - Significant learning curve for new hires, so onboarding could use a lot of improvement to bring new hires up to speed. - Team Lead positions need more vetting to prevent putting the wrong person in a position of leading others.
